Intended Use
For the examination of materials encountered in brewing and for industrial fermentations containing mixed flora of yeasts and bacteria.
Principle and Interpretation
Yeast extract and casein enzymic hydrolysate provide nitrogen source, vitamins, and growth factors; glucose is fermentable sugar; potassium dihydrogen phosphate is an acid-base buffer; potassium chloride, calcium chloride, and ferric chloride maintain the osmotic pressure of the culture medium; magnesium sulfate and manganese sulfate provide divalent cations; various positive ions are provided; bromocresol green is an acid-base indicator; agar is a coagulant.
Formulation
Ingredients | /liter |
Yeast extract | 4.0g |
Casein enzymic hydrolysate(Tryptone) | 5.0g |
Glucose | 50.0g |
Potassium dihydrogen phosphate | 0.55g |
Potassium chloride | 0.425g |
Calcium chloride | 0.125 g |
Magnesium sulfate | 0.125 g |
Ferric chloride | 0.0025 g |
Manganese sulfate | 0.0025 g |
Bromocresol green | 0.022 g |
Agar | 17.0g |
pH5.5±0.2 at 25°C |
Preparation
Suspend 77.3g in 1 litre distilled water. Heat to boiling to dissolve the medium completely. Sterilize by autoclaving at 121°C for 15 minutes..
Quality Control
Cultural characteristics observed after incubation at 30+/-2°C for 48-72hhours
Quality control strains | Inoculum CFU | Expected Result |
Saccharomyces cerevisiae ATCC9763 | 10-100 | >50%,green colonies with dark green centres |
Storage and Shelf Life
2-30℃,Keep container tightly closed, avoid direct sunlight.
Use before expiry date on the label.
Precautions
1. When weighing the dehydrated medium, please wear masks to avoid causing respiratory system discomfort
2. Keep container tightly closed after using to prevent clumping.
Waste Disposal
Microbiological contamination was disposed by autoclaving at 121°C for 30 minutes.
